Hercules woman's death investigated as homicide

HERCULES, Calif.

Family and friends rushed to the home on Ash Court and Redwood Road Saturday morning, "I didn't believe it until I got here," said the victim's friend, Big Au. "Shocking, it's just shocking."

Neighbors say the woman living there for 25 years was Susie Ko. Police say she was supposed to pick her husband up at the Oakland airport Friday night but never made it. Ko's husband called a neighbor who entered the house and found her lying in the entryway. The neighbor told police there was blood around her body. The family car, a sky blue 2011 Subaru Outback with an Idaho license plate, was missing from the garage.

"It's a tragedy," said neighbor Aaron. "It doesn't matter what neighborhood it happened in, you know. Killing and a robbery or something like that is just a tragedy. It doesn't matter if it happens in Oakland, Richmond, Hercules, Pinole. It's just a tragedy.

Neighbor Nick Andrews added, "She was nice, no one had complaints with her, it's just, it's sad."

Besides being well liked the victim was also an avid gardener who would spend most of the time in her yard.

Police have no motive or suspects in the death, which has now left the once quiet cul-de-sac on edge. The cause is under investigation, but police are treating it as a homicide. Officials say the victim suffered a "traumatic injury."
